Transaction 172a39f14fbed2676862dbee0767bd2afead5b7d8f336a224e0f8b042646df60
1 Input
1 Output
-
172a39f14fbed2676862dbee0767bd2afead5b7d8f336a224e0f8b042646df60:0
- value
- 1651651
- script pubkey
- OP_0 OP_PUSHBYTES_20 72b2bb3a75e0b917a48169ba8493c8ea6e4b1fa8
- address
- bc1qw2etkwn4uzu30fypdxagfy7gafhyk8ag6a9hfl